Transaction 18629357e281f57e33eae4fd63aeb0bc9c80089edd1fb905c9af7d931bde4e27
1 Input
1 Output
-
18629357e281f57e33eae4fd63aeb0bc9c80089edd1fb905c9af7d931bde4e27:0
- value
- 1052850
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0b7b3df0a1a01804a1789adbcb46d35e7e879f5
- address
- bc1q6zmm8hc2rgqcqjsh3xkmedrdxhn7s704ykywy5